My Buying Guides on Yogi Bedtime Tea Harmful

My First Thoughts Before Buying

When I first looked into Yogi Bedtime Tea, I wanted something calming to help me relax at night. Before buying, I checked whether it could be harmful for my body, especially because I am careful about herbal teas and how they affect sleep, digestion, and medications.

What I Looked For on the Label

I always read the ingredient list first. For Yogi Bedtime Tea, I checked for herbs like valerian root, chamomile, lavender, and licorice root. I wanted to know if any ingredient might cause side effects for me, such as drowsiness, stomach discomfort, or interactions with medicines.

Possible Harmful Effects I Considered

From my research, I learned that herbal teas can affect people differently. I paid attention to possible issues like:

  • Excessive sleepiness
  • Upset stomach
  • Allergic reactions
  • Headaches
  • Interaction with sleep aids, antidepressants, or blood pressure medicines

I reminded myself that even “natural” products can still cause problems if I use them too often or if my body reacts badly.

Who Should Be Extra Careful

I would be especially cautious if I were:

  • Pregnant or breastfeeding
  • Taking prescription medicine
  • Sensitive to herbs or flowers
  • Dealing with liver, kidney, or blood pressure concerns
  • Already using other calming or sleep products

For me, this meant I should not assume the tea is automatically safe just because it is herbal.

Final Thoughts

In my view, Yogi Bedtime Tea is not necessarily harmful for most people when used as directed, but I still think it’s important to be cautious. I would pay attention to how my body reacts, especially if I’m pregnant, taking medications, or sensitive to herbal ingredients like valerian or chamomile. My takeaway is that it can be a helpful sleep aid for some, but I’d use it thoughtfully and talk to a healthcare professional if I had any concerns.
